WebFeb 3, 2016 · Although Yasi was one of the most powerful cyclones to have affected Queenslanders since records commenced, only one cyclone-related death was recorded. A man died while sheltering in his home, asphyxiated on fumes spewed out by a generator he was using in a confined space.
